After years of anticipation, Pi Network is finally entering the open market. On February 20, 2025, at 08:00 AM UTC (1:30 PM IST) which is 3 AM in New York (EST), 8 AM GMT in the UK, and 4 PM CST/SGT in Singapore & Beijing, marking a huge milestone for millions of users worldwide.

This launch officially marks the end of the Enclosed Mainnet phase (which started in December 2021), effectively keeping Pi’s ecosystem under lock and key from external trading. Pioneers can start trading Pi now on Google, and vendors can finally expand their apps to the global stage. Expect real-world transactions, bigger adoption, and a growing ecosystem.

But the biggest question remains, how much will 1 Pi be worth? Current IOU prices put it around $61–$70, though some bold predictions suggest it could hit $331.40 by March 2025. That said, market demand will decide the real value once trading starts.
